3. In Article 2—U.K.
(a)in the text before paragraph 1 omit “shall”;
(b)in paragraphs 1 to 3, 6, 7, 12 to 15 and 17 for “shall mean” substitute “ means ”;
(c)in paragraph 1—
[F1(i)for “Community market” substitute “ market of Great Britain ”;]
(ii)at the end, insert “ and related expressions must be construed accordingly ”;
(d)in paragraph 2—
[F2(i)for “Community market” substitute “ market of Great Britain ”;]
(ii)at the end, insert “ and related expressions must be construed accordingly ”;
F3(e). .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. .
(f)for paragraph 5 substitute—
“5. “importer” means any person established in the United Kingdom who places a product from a country outside of the United Kingdom on the market;”;
(g)omit paragraphs 8 and 9;
(h)for paragraph 10 substitute—
“10. “accreditation” means an attestation by a national accreditation body conveying formal recognition that a conformity assessment body is competent to carry out a specific conformity assessment activity;”;
(i)for paragraph 11 substitute—
“11. “UK national accreditation body” means the body appointed by the Secretary of State in accordance with Article 4;”;
(j)omit paragraph 16;
(k)in paragraph 17 for “the relevant Community harmonisation legislation” substitute “ any relevant enactment; ”;
(l)for paragraph 18 substitute—
“18. “market surveillance authority” means an authority responsible for carrying out market surveillance in the United Kingdom;”;
(m)for paragraph 19 substitute—
“19. “the free circulation procedure” means the procedure set out in Schedule 1 to the Taxation (Cross-border Trade) Act 2018 M1;”;
(n)for paragraph 20 substitute—
“20. “conformity marking” means a marking, such as the UK marking, by which the manufacturer indicates that a product is in conformity with the applicable requirements of any enactment providing for the affixing such a marking;”;
(o)for paragraph 21 substitute—
“21. “relevant enactment” means any retained EU law [F4, as it applies in Great Britain, ] derived from an EU instrument harmonising the conditions for the marketing of products in the EU;”;
(p)after paragraph 21 insert—
“22. “UK marking” means the marking in the form set out in Annex 2.”.
